Understanding Car Locksmith Services

A car locksmith car is a specialized locksmith who focuses on automotive locks and keys. They are geared up to manage a large range of problems, from easy key duplications to complicated electronic key programming. Mobile car locksmiths, in particular, are experts who can pertain to your area, whether you are at home, work, or on the side of the roadway, to offer instant support.

Services Offered by Car Locksmiths

  1. Key Duplication

    • Standard Keys: If you require an additional key for your vehicle, a car locksmith can quickly replicate your existing key.
    • Remote Keys: For lorries with keyless entry systems, car locksmith professionals can program and replicate remote keys, ensuring you can open and begin your car without concerns.
  2. Lockout Assistance

    • ** opening Doors **: If you've locked your type in the car, a mobile car locksmith can securely open your vehicle without triggering dam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.
    • Ignition Lockout: For scenarios where you can't start your car because the key is stuck in the ignition, a car locksmith can assist extract it.
  3. Key Replacement

    • Lost Keys: If you've lost your car key, a locksmith can create a brand-new one using the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a spare key.
    • Broken Keys: If your key is harmed or broken, a locksmith can replace it and make certain the brand-new key works seamlessly with your car.
  4. Transponder Key Programming

    • New Keys: Many modern-day cars come with transponder keys, which need programming to the car's onboard computer. An expert car locksmith can program a new transponder key to ensure it operates properly.
    • Reprogramming: If your transponder key has actually quit working, a locksmith can reprogram it to restore its performance.
  5. Lock Installation and Repair

    • New Locks: If your car's locks are broken or damaged, a car locksmith can install brand-new, top quality locks.
    • Lock Repair: For small concerns like sticking or jammed locks, a locksmith can repair them to make sure smooth operation.
  6. Security Upgrades

    • High-Security Locks: For included assurance, a car locksmith can set up high-security locks that are more resistant to tampering and theft.
    • Immobilizer Systems: These advanced security systems avoid your car from starting if the correct key is not present. A car locksmith can set up and program immobilizer systems.

FAQs About Car Locksmith Services

Q1: Can a mobile car locksmith aid if I lock my keys in the car?

  • A1: Yes, a mobile car locksmith can securely unlock your car without causing any damage. They are equipped with tools and methods to deal with numerous lockout circumstances.

Q2: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key made?

  • A2: The expense can vary depending on the type of key and the intricacy of the vehicle's lock system. Standard keys can cost anywhere from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, while remote and transponder keys can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 or more.

Q3: Can a locksmith program a brand-new transponder key?

  • A3: Yes, an expert car locksmith can program a new transponder key to your vehicle's onboard computer. This is a common service for modern-day automobiles that need this kind of key.

Q4: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?

  • A4: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not attempt to force it out. Rather, call a mobile car locksmith who can safely extract the broken key and provide a replacement if required.

Q5: How can I avoid being locked out of my car?

  • A5: Keep a spare key in a safe place, such as a trusted pal's house or a protected key box. Routinely inspect your car locks for wear and tear and have them serviced by a professional locksmith.

Q6: Are mobile car locksmith professionals reliable?

  • A6: Yes, mobile car locksmiths are normally trustworthy. Search for experts with great reviews, proper licensing, and a track record of pleased customers.

Tips for Maintaining Your Car Locks and Keys

  1. Routine Lubrication

    • Use a silicone-based lube to keep your locks and keys moving efficiently. This can prevent wear and tear and lower the risk of lockouts.
  2. Avoid Excessive Force

    • When inserting or turning your key, avoid using extreme force. This can harm the lock or key and cause more major problems.
  3. Keep Your Keys Safe

    • Store your car type in a safe and available place. Avoid putting them near windows or in locations where they can be quickly stolen.
  4. Inspect Locks Regularly

    • Routinely inspect your car locks for any indications of wear, rust, or damage. If you see any concerns, have them examined and repaired by a professional locksmith.
  5. Consider Keyless Entry Systems

    • If your vehicle supports it, consider upgrading to a keyless entry system. These systems can minimize the threat of lockouts and offer extra security.
